    (Dined 06/20/2025 FR @ 8:00pm): Thailand (not Siam)... delightful food for anyone who tried it! In my quest to explore the various cuisine scenes and things to do throughout Jersey City and specifically the Heights, my dear friend and hers recommended One Dee Siam. They've eaten here before, and I had it on my bookmark list, so I was excited to give it a whirl. I loved Thai food, would eat it every day if I could, and it was generally healthy. Actually a play on words of their sister location in New York City's Hell's Kitchen (Wondee Siam), I also found the use of Thailand's former name, "Siam", kind of intriguing whether or not it was rooted more in historical nostalgia and national pride. Would I be one delighted diner at this Siam cuisine eatery!? PURCHASE Fried Tofu w/Sweet Chili Sauce & Ground Peanuts ($8.95): With a crispy exterior and a spongy inside, dipping it into the provided mild sauce made for a plentiful delightful snacking treat! https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=0&select=lHYuvRwG5T5i-NxMk5L8iQ 3pc Curry Puffs w/Thai Cucumber Vinaigrette ($8.95): Sadly, because I observed no-meat Friday, I wasn't able to fully enjoy this minced-chicken appetizer, but for the crumbled bits I tried, it was lovely enough. https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=0&select=4N_FYjHBM0mhFdLychiXqQ Pineapple Red Curry w/Red Snapper Fish ($65.00): Ordered off of their specials menu which didn't have any listed prices, I was stung with sticker shock when I received the check! However, this was a massive portion of two large thick filets, juicy pineapple chunks, some cleansing vegetables, and slow-burn red curry which affected me once I got home. I had this for two glorious meals! Pricey for sure, but damn this was impressive! https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=0&select=c9rfnITJMMJ4G3uWU3wmNA Steamed Rice (INCLUDED): Served in a whimsical cone shape, this white steamed fluffiness of rice paired well with my entree but nothing special. https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=0&select=HPd1MmSc6LDmhz8Dtj_Jkw SERVICE We were a walk-in party of four, so thankfully, we were warmly greeted by a kind young woman who led us to a nearby open table. She handed us each a menu, brought some glasses of water, and gave us time to peruse the menu. Minutes later, a young man approached us if we were ready to order, if we had any questions, and briefly explained the evening's specials (which most of us ordered from). Because they didn't serve alcohol, they allowed BYOB fee-free - woo hoo! About ten minutes later, the appetizers arrived, and then another ten minutes passed before our entrees came out. They checked in on us, cleared away any empties, eventually boxed up our leftovers, and wished us a good evening and hopefully a return visit. Everything was wonderful - khop khun! PARKING (Street; N/A this instance) Although this was an easy 25-minute walk from my friend's place, we took a quick 10-minute Lyft because of the hot weather. Otherwise, this was on a pedestrian-only section of town, but there appeared to be random spots (no known private lot) off the main drag of Newark Ave. and all surrounding roads, or best to utilize the very good public transportation light rail - 'nuff said. ATMOSPHERE, DÉCOR, AMBIENCE A very clean modern-looking restaurant with a ton of dining chairs/tables that left little space between each other, the decor was more bistro with accents of Thai embellishments. A good amount of natural lighting came through the tinted large windows and doors while bright electric decorative ceiling lights https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=24&select=A29UfO7_28aBkuRguQXyyw filled in the rest. There were no TVs while low-volumed pop music played in the background. https://www.yelp.com/user_local_photos?userid=8jVT2inwc8GIQ6sH2UG9Vw&start=24&select=pxqhxOKw1feChA15uKlLRQ ATTIRE Totally casual, so I would normally be in a t-shirt, boardshorts, and flip-flops. OVERALL One Dee Siam was da bomb, and I hoped to return to try other items on their reasonably expansive menu! Everything smelled and tasted wonderfully, the portions were huge, the prices very generally affordable (they really should put pieces on the specials menu), the service was friendly and straightforward, and I appreciated that they allowed BYOB without a corkage fee (we shared a bottle of wine). And, I always loved supporting small businesses whenever possible. I found complete value based on the prices, service, and experience noted above (TOTAL paid experience was around $88.00 BEFORE any discounts and/or tip). And, they accepted my credit card of choice... AMEX! 5.0 STARS

    Floral contemporary decor sets a modern urban ambiance. Situated in a vibrant Jersey City neighborhood, this place is a gem. Understated from the pedestrianized pavement and greeted by BYOB sign. Started Steamed Dumplings accompanied by Shrimp Tom Yum soup. The Kanom Jeeb dumplings were tender and packed with flavor, the soup however needed a little more to it as I found it very one dimensional in terms of that sourness that needs the Umami to balance. Shrimps were tender and not overcooked. For the main event I chose Crispy Duck Gra Pow served with white rice. It was a stand out!

    Food (4/5): We ordered the soft shell chili crab, Thai salad, and One Dee noodle soup. The Thai salad had a nice combination of fresh vegetables and I liked the addition of the peanut sauce. The Thai salad was average. Had a good amount of veggies but it felt like a regular salad with peanut sauce. The soft shell chili crab was solid but not spicy at all and was too salty. The One Dee noodle soup was excellent! Definitely my favorite dish of the meal. The broth was super flavorful. I also really liked the mango sticky for dessert. The mango was the right amount of ripeness and the sticky rice was sweet and delicious. Service (3/5): Decent service but they didn't check up on us frequently. The servers were helpful when we asked and helped provide recommendations. Ambiance (4/5): Beautifully laid out restaurant with nice lights decorating the ceiling and a wall of flowers. The ambiance was very chill with relaxing music. Also liked how it was well lit. The walkway to the restroom had cool art. My only complaint is that the seating to other guests is way too close especially for the booth tables.
